I don't think you can compare the two.

Don't get me wrong, they're both similarly priced and are direct competitors, but from what I've heard and read the driving experience could not be any more different.

I'm a HUGE Nissan GTR fan (one of my favorite cars of all time), and it's basically a computer on wheels. Every part of the GTR is pretty much calibrated and programmed for optimal performance. AWD, Launch Control, dual clutch transmission, you're basically driving a computer.

The Porsche on the other hand is a more driver-oriented car. It's RWD and uses a standard manual for more driver involvement. A GTR is completely controlled and a precision rocket, the Porsche is more like a car where the skill of the driver really plays into effect.
